WebJul 2, 2024 · 16. For patients with HP ≥10 mm, repeat colonoscopy in 3-5 years. A 3-year follow-up interval is favored if concern about pathologist consistency in distinguishing SSPs from HPs, quality of bowel preparation, or complete polyp excision, whereas a 5-year interval is favored if low concerns for consistency in distinguishing between SSP and HP ... A polypectomy is a procedure used to remove polyps from the inside of the colon, also called the large intestine. A polyp is an abnormal collection of tissue.
